In case you need to install commercial roofing in Atlanta, built-up roofs can be a very good idea, due to their numerous benefits. This type of material is very good for flat roofing systems. When the materials are of high quality, there are plenty of advantages related to it.

A top Atlanta commercial roofing contractor affirms that built-up roofs are very low maintenance. Because it is made of very large sheets, this type of roof is less prone to damage. Thus, you get a worry-free type of roofing system for your home.

Although they are affordable, built-up roofs are also very resistant in time. As a matter of fact, they can last for more than 30 years. Because of the layers that built-up roofs have, moisture can less easily penetrate roofing systems.

Roofing systems built this way offer a higher degree of insulation. This helps to keep the building cool in the hot season. But these layers can also offer different types of protection. Ballasted asphalt can offer fire protection, for instance. Repairs can be easily done when something goes wrong. Built-up roofing is affordable and convenient from this point of view also.

As they are basically leak-proof, BUR roofing systems can last for many years and that is why many commercial business owners choose them.

If you are in charge of a commercial building in Atlanta, having the number of a local Atlanta commercial roofing contractor on speed dial is very important. If you have recently started your activity as the building’s manager, it is even more important to arrange for a meeting with your Atlanta commercial roofer to discuss your concerns. Here are some topics that you might want to bring up:

  • The condition of your roof – ideally, your commercial roof should be inspected by a professional twice a year, in spring and in fall, to ensure the continued good performance of your roof. These inspection and maintenance visits are usually very affordable and most commercial roofers also offer maintenance programs that you can enroll your roof into, so if your roof is not yet enrolled into such a program, discuss the option with your contractor.
  • Upcoming roof repairs – knowing what is next is always important if you are a building manager, so another important topic to discuss with your roofer is whether there are any important repairs that should be completed soon.
  • The life span of your roof – having an idea about how long you can expect your roof to stay on your building without being affected by major problems is another important issue. Your contractor will provide an evaluation of your roof based on the roof’s age as well as its condition.

 

Care and Maintenance Tips for TPO Roofing

A TPO roof membrane does not contain plasticizers or flame retardants that contain halogen, which results in a very high resistance to UV radiation and ozone. In addition, it is resistant to fungi, algae and chemicals. TPO membranes are also available in light colors, which ensure better protection against UV radiation and weather.

However, all these advantages do not mean that this type of roofing material does not need maintenance. According respected flat roofing Atlanta contractor, periodic maintenance is a must, in order to enjoy these benefits for as long as possible, and it refers, most often, to cleaning and checking up the roof.

TPO membrane cleaning tips:

  1. Protect any area on the roof where water could enter when using pressurized water.
  2. Protect plants and exterior facades from the roof cleaning solution that might end up on them.
  3. Sweep the roof of leaves and twigs.
  4. Use low pressure water to clean and rinse the top layer of dust and dirt
  5. Use a soft brush or a soft floor mop with a cleaning solution consisting of warm water and a mild, non-abrasive and environmentally friendly detergent.
  6. Rinse the roof thoroughly.
  7. Inspect the membrane and make sure that no damage has occurred; any defects must be repaired as soon as possible by an Atlanta commercial roofer
